Ticket: Validator plugin registry fails to load third-party schemas after the Quillworth 4.2 rollout. The plugin loader in Fenbrook's validation core now rejects any validator that declares optional dependencies, which breaks the Marretta team's CSV checkers in production. Workaround is pinning the registry to the previous manifest format. Please confirm whether the loader change was intentional before we revert. The failing build token is below.

session token of bawep-yadup = htk21_528abd376e3c5a4ec24a1

## Inbound: Recalled Charger Pallet

Heads up, Marnwick team — a full pallet of the recalled VoltNook travel chargers is coming back from the Tellbrook depot this week. Don't restock any of it; it all goes straight to the quarantine cage by dock 3. Shrink-wrap stays on until QA signs off. The courier hand-over instruction below is confidential, so keep it off the board.

handover note for yagef-bagep: the drudor pelius courier leaves the kasdor zorvan norir ledger at gate 8016 under passcode 755406

## Fuel Report Access

FleetGauge generates the weekly fuel-usage report for Ostermann Haulage dispatchers. Support handles regen requests when numbers look off. Rerun requires the report worker locally: clone the fleetgauge-reports repo, install deps, copy env.sample to .env. The worker pulls telemetry from the Kembric data lake and needs a credential to do so. Add the access token on the next line:

vault entry, yajep-fajop: ARCHIVE_KEY3=4c0

## Deploy Status Bot Provenance

Every message posted by Quillwick, our deploy status bot, is tied to a verifiable build record. Before trusting a status update, new team members should confirm the message originated from the Fennelgate pipeline and not a replay. The bot signs each announcement with the pipeline run that produced the artifact, and it records the signing step in the audit ledger. The canonical reference for today's production rollout is listed directly below this line.

build token for yaweg-yahof: htk21_f96f8eef8d266af57c98e